Editors’ Review
The New Damon PS2 Pro Emulator offers users the ability to play PlayStation 2 (PS2) games on their mobile devices.
As one of the few emulators that attempt to replicate the experience of the PS2 console on Android smartphones, it caters to retro gamers looking to enjoy classic titles on the go.
By emulating PS2 hardware, New Damon PS2 Pro Emulator seeks to bring a wide array of games into the palm of your hand, offering high compatibility with many of the platform’s most beloved titles.
The emulator’s primary appeal lies in its ability to run a large number of PS2 games. New Damon PS2 Pro Emulator supports popular titles, including classics like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as and Final Fantasy X, making it a suitable option for those eager to revisit these games on mobile devices.
In comparison to other mobile emulators, such as PPSSPP (a PSP emulator), New Damon PS2 Pro Emulator boasts a larger library of supported games, but the performance may vary depending on the specific game and the device’s hardware.
The emulator offers a relatively straightforward user interface, allowing users to easily navigate through game lists, load saved states, and adjust settings.
Additionally, New Damon PS2 Pro Emulator provides several optimization features to improve performance, such as frame-skip options, texture scaling, and resolution adjustments.
While these optimizations help balance performance and visual quality, users may still experience occasional frame drops or glitches depending on the game being played and their phone’s capabilities.
While New Damon PS2 Pro Emulator performs well with many PS2 games, some high-end titles may not run as smoothly as others. Games with complex graphics or larger maps, such as Shadow of the Colossus, can experience performance slowdowns or visual bugs.
Comparatively, mobile emulators for less demanding consoles, such as GBA.emu for Game Boy Advance games, generally offer smoother experiences due to the lower hardware requirements. Additionally, the emulator works best on more powerful Android devices with at least 4GB of RAM and strong GPUs. Older or lower-end devices may struggle with certain games, limiting the user experience.
New Damon PS2 Pro Emulator does not come with preloaded game content. Users must source their own PS2 game files, which introduces legal concerns. Emulating games may violate copyright laws unless the user owns the original copies.
Bottom Line
New Damon PS2 Pro Emulator provides a robust platform for playing PS2 games on Android, but it is not without its limitations. While the emulator boasts good game compatibility, easy-to-use features, and optimizations, performance issues and its premium model may present challenges for some users.
However, for retro gaming lovers who want to enjoy PS2 classics on their mobile devices, this emulator offers a solid solution for reliving those gaming moments on the go.
